Cosnine Decides to Issue Convertible Bonds Worth 14 Billion KRW
Cosnine announced on the 14th that it has decided to issue 14 billion KRW worth of unsecured private convertible bonds to Shilla Asset Management to raise funds for debt repayment. The coupon rate is 3%, the maturity interest rate is 9%, and the bond maturity date is May 11, 2026.
